    Freshwater Drum

    The Wife and I went fishing for a few hours last Sunday, here:



    And amongst others (caught seven different species, over two dozen fish) we kept some Freshwater Drum.



    Something I haven't had snce I was a kid, and one that has a reputation for being a strong tasting 'fatty' fish, not worth keeping.

    Not being one to follow modern convention, naturally I kept a few and cooked them up...




    I decided to play around a little to give them a fair chance...
    All fish were filleted and de-boned as a walleye, but with a little extra libery to cut off the fatty looking meat at the belly

    1. First fillet went straight into the hot cast iron pan with a little butter/olive oil, no seasoning/spices.
    Review: Overall ok, fairly strong 'fish' taste that I didn't mind but my wife didn't care for. Nice firm flaky white meat.

    2. Second fillet lightly dusted with Shore lunch Italian and pan fried the same as above.
    Review: slightly less 'fishy' tasting, but still not a fav. for the wife.

    3. Third fillet lightly dusted in Shore lunch cajun and pan fried the same.
    Review: I quite enjoyed this one, but it presented the problem of still being too 'fishy' and now too spicy for the wife. lol.

    4. Fourth fillet, bare went into a simmering pan of Italian salad dressing and poached.
    review: Best so far, a lot less fishy taste, still not a fav for the wife.
    Note: This is her favourite way for Walleye.

    5. Soaked fillet in milk for about a half hour, rinsed and pan fried same as #1.
    Review: Next to no 'fishy' taste, wife approved!

    6. Soaked as above, then cooked in salad dressing like #4.
    Review: Couldn't tell the difference in taste between the drum, smallmouth bass and walleye. Texture VERY similar to walleye.

    Overall impression:

    A versatile fish, with some flavour. If people are not fans of strong tasting fish (orange roughie, bluefish, etc.) they wouldn't like the first four methods tried, but I do and I did. For the tamer at heart, the milk soaking did wonders to remove the gamyness and make it enjoyable for my wife.

    I would definately keep them again in the future!

    My objection to fishy taste drops with my level of hunger. LOL. Surprisingly, most Americans do not like the taste of fish. All kidding aside wild tasting meat or fish usually can be reduced with a several hour soak in milk. Not sure of the chemistry but it works. Glad you had a fun trip. I am jealous.
